Types of GraphsYou are likely to meet only two types of graphs in IELTS or other intermediate English tests - time and comparison graphs.
Here is a time graph.
You have to compare different methods of transport used in the US over the last century - train, bus and air. You could start with
The main trend with rail transport is that it rose to a peak in the 1920s and 1930s and then declined. The main trend with air is that it started late, in the 1960s, but it has shot up to become by far the biggest carrier of passengers
You have to compare the amount of water used for domestic, agricultural and industrial purposes. There are two ways to write about this graph:
Start with Agriculture because it is the biggest user. Group together Saudi Arabia and Oman as the top users, and then group UAE and Qatar as the middle group of users, using 60% of water for agriculture. Finally mention Bahrain and Kuwait. Your second paragraph should be about Domestic use, the use of water in the home, because it is the second biggest use. Start with Kuwait and Bahrain (grouped together) (more than 50%) and then write about Qatar and the UAE. Back to top |
